Ben Thistlewood, Leevale AC, is the Cork City Sports Athlete of the
Month for December. Ben receives the award for his win in the Athletics
Ireland National Novice Cross-Country Championships, held in Santry
Demesne, Dublin last month. In addition to winning the event, Ben
led both his club, Leevale AC, and Cork to the respective club and
county team title. Describing his tactics for the event, Ben said that
he had received great advice from his Leevale coach, Donie Walsh, who
advised him to bide his time and go when he felt it was right, so he
held back until the final lap, when he upped the pressure on his
remaining opponents, making his final, and decisive, burst for home
with 400m to go. During the interview, Ben outlined some
elements of his training regime...but asked that they remain
"undisclosed".
A 27 year old medical student from Summerland, British Colombia,
Canada, Ben is also PRO for UCC Athletics Club. Ben placed 5th in both
the 2012 and 2013 events, and, for the past two years, he had been
aiming to win the National Novice Championship. Now that he has
achieved this target, he has set his sights on the 5000m and 10000m in
the World University Games, in Gwangju, South Korea (Jul 3rd-14th
2015). The qualification standards are 14:06.00 and 29:45.00,
respectively. Ben's PBs are 14:43.47 (Eugene, Oregon, 2011) and
31:01 (Vancouver Canada, 2012)
A medical student in UCC, Ben has an athletic scholarship and has
approx. 18 months remaining for his studies here. His first Irish
win was in the Eagle AC Cheetah Run in 2013.
